Taylor Hall's value was likely less than a third-round pick
That is, despite his lowered trade stock, arguably below the value of a third-round pick, thanks to declining production and injury history, the Blackhawks got a third-rounder out of the deal.
Only because Colorado required a third team to get it done was that possible. Without that, the market value of Hall probably yields a far lesser return.
Hall's time in Chicago was largely unfruitful. The 33-year-old never really rounded back into form after starting the 2023-24 season on the injured list, missing most of the season due to surgery to repair a torn ACL.
He scored only twice in his first 20 games this season and, after a brief spurt with a hat trick against Dallas on Nov. 27, managed only four goals and 11 assists over the next 25.
Now with his seventh NHL team,
Hall has 721 points in 879 career games as he remains in the chase for playoff success.
He's a former first-overall pick who has yet to move beyond the second round of the Stanley Cup Playoffs, further complicating an already complicated career narrative.
